Analysis of Headway

Overall verdict

  • Headway is a well-designed and popular app that offers digestible book summaries, making it a solid choice for people who want to absorb key ideas from nonfiction books quickly and consistently.

Why this product is good

  • Provides concise 15-minute summaries of popular nonfiction books, saving time
  • Offers both text and audio formats for flexible learning on the go
  • Features a clean, user-friendly interface with gamification and progress tracking to build habits
  • Covers a wide range of topics including personal growth, productivity, business, and psychology
  • Includes daily insights and personalized recommendations to keep users engaged

Recommended for

  • Busy professionals who want to learn key concepts without reading full books
  • People looking to build a consistent self-improvement or learning habit
  • Fans of nonfiction and personal development content
  • Commuters or multitaskers who prefer audio learning
  • Anyone wanting an affordable alternative to buying many full-length books
